Double team wins for Harriers at Colchester 10km
Colchester Harriers surged to a double team win at the Colchester 10km held from their base at the Garrison track. Ramadam Osman was first home in 2nd spot clocking 33:16 on a warm and windy morning. Joining him in the winning team was Colin Ridley 3rd in 35:06 and Mark Harrod 6TH 35:57. Danny Millward 7th 36:18 and Paul Rodgers 10th 36:47 all ran well. The ladies were led home by Sarah Stradling who at last is back to racing winning in 38:26 with Laura Shewbridge 2nd 39:30 and Lucy Mapp 3rd 40:29. The ladies were obviously the team winners. There was age category awards for Mark Harrod, David Wright 40:11, Arthur Whiston 44:31, Andy Raynor 37:35 and John Wheatley 51:00.

Harwich 5km series
The Harwich evening 5km series got under way in reasonably good conditions along the sea front, Danny Millward was the fastest harrier on the night and second fastest overall in 17:15, Tom Cresswell 17:51 and Paul Preston 17:57 were in good form, while Andy Raynor ran a personal best 18:10. Laura Shewbridge was flying clocking a superb 18:51. Others to run were Sharon Frost 24:01, Joseph Boden 18:18 (PB), Aaron Marley 18:39, Keith Marley 18:28, Ady Frost 20:09, Steve Clark 22:09.
Maldon 5k series
At the Maldon 5km evening promenade run harriers Had a big turn out with Danny Millward again leading the way clocking 17.00 for 2nd placed, over 55 runner Colin Ridley is still at his best finishing 3rd in 17:04, then came Paul Rodgers 5th 17:45 and Aaron Marley 6th in a personal best 17:52. Helen Bloomfield was first lady in 20:04. Other races
Angus Holford swept to victory in the North Carolina State mile while working in the USA running a superb 4:28.
Rachel Rodgers did well at the Nuclear fall out race held in Kent a severe race with many obstacles, the winner was 2nd claim Harrier and Essex marathon champion Tristan Steed, who then repeated the event the next day .!
At the Park runs Chris Sellens won Great Cornard in 16:55, with Wayne cook 3rd 17:38, Tom Cresswell 4th 17:50 and Drew Olley 5th 18:31, Rob Gibby made a running come back in 20:01. Colchester Castle saw Anthony Barraclough 4th in 18:10, with Joseph Boden 8th 19:30, Helen Bloomfield was first lady in 20:17.Russel Goodridge was 3rd at the Mersea event with David Wright 4th, Chris Smith 5th and Simon Smith 6th, Fran Norris and Fay Smalls also ran well.
